Heard this on the wireless earlier (hoping I understood this right ) When the new system starts of having no actual tax disc to display, if you buy a taxed car then the unused portion of tax will be refunded to original owner, so the new owner must buy their own tax before driving the vehicle.

    it's a great stealth way of losing a months tax, sell your car on the 27th may and taxed until end june - get a month back, sell on june 1 you lose it all but new owner has to buy a month....
     
  8. Approx 40 million vehicles in the UK, each disc costs approximately £7 to create, administer and send, all the records are electronic anyway. You do the maths. :)
     
  9. £280 million (just for @poptop2 'cos he can't count)
